The Biomechanics Graduate Certificate is designed for individuals seeking an advanced understanding of biomechanics and musculoskeletal functionality. The program is 100% online, making it possible to pursue graduate-level study without geographic restrictions while continuing to work or meet other commitments.
Students build knowledge across a broad range of biomechanics applications, from sport and human performance to aging and occupational settings. Coursework also introduces biomechanics instrumentation and applied data collection, giving students the opportunity to connect foundational concepts with hands-on data and interpretation.

The Biomechanics Graduate Certificate follows a four-course sequence that moves from foundational biomechanics and musculoskeletal movement to clinical applications, injury biomechanics, applied biomechanics and measurement.
The program is self-paced within each 16-week course. Because the first two courses must be completed before the final two courses, students enter the program in the fall semester. Foundations of Biomechanics and Musculoskeletal & Movement Biomechanics are offered in fall, followed by Clinical Applications & Injury Biomechanics and Applied Biomechanics and Measurement in spring.
